I was writing a xml data reader in Java using JDK’s inbuilt XML processing libraries (JAXP) when I persistently hit across this annoying exception with error message: A pseudo attribute name is expected. J'ai été la rédaction d'un lecteur de données XML en Java en utilisant le JDK incorporé traitement bibliothèques XML (JAXP) lorsque j'ai touché à travers la persistance de cette exception ennuyeux avec un message d'erreur: un pseudo attribut nom est attendue. The error is displayed on the first line itself. L'erreur est affiché sur la première ligne elle-même.

Google search wasn’t of much help. De recherche Google n'a pas été d'un grand secours. I tried few suggestions, which were not of any use. J'ai essayé quelques suggestions, qui n'ont pas été d'une quelconque utilité. Then I noticed the obvious. Puis, j'ai remarqué une évidence.

My xml instruction was: Mon XML instruction était la suivante:
< ?xml version="1.0" > <? Xml version = "1,0">

It was a typo. Il a été une faute de frappe. It should have been: Il aurait dû être:
< ?xml version="1.0" ?> <? Xml version = "1,0"?>

Obviously the xml instruction was illegal. De toute évidence, l'instruction xml était illégale. However the error message was cryptic and gave no hint to the actual cause of the problem. Toutefois, le message d'erreur est crypté et ne donne aucune indication à la cause réelle du problème.